6 | Commissioning

6.3 Leak test

Carry out the leak test on the refrigerating plant in accordance with UL 207 or a corresponding
safety standard, while always observing the maximum permissible overpressure for the compressor.

6.4 Evacuation

First evacuate the system and then include the compressor in the evacuation process.
Relieve the compressor pressure.
Open the suction and pressure line shut-off valves.
Evacuate the suction and discharge pressure sides using the vacuum pump.
At the end of the evacuation process, the vacuum should be < 1.5 mbar when the pump is switched off.
Repeat this process as often as is required.

6.5 Refrigerant charge

Make sure that the suction and pressure line shut-off valves are open.
With the compressor switched off, add the liquid refrigerant directly to the condenser or receiver,
breaking the vacuum.
If the refrigerant needs topping up after starting the compressor, it can be topped up in vapor form
on the suction side, or, taking suitable precautions, also in liquid form at the inlet to the evapora-
tor.

Risk of bursting!
The compressor must only be pressurized using nitrogen (N
Never pressurize with oxygen or other gases!
The maximum permissible overpressure of the compressor must
not be exceeded at any time during the testing process (see name
plate data)! Do not mix any refrigerant with the nitrogen as this
could cause the ignition limit to shift into the critical range.
Do not start the compressor if it is under vacuum. Do not apply
any voltage - even for test purposes (must only be operated with
refrigerant).
Under vacuum, the spark-over and creepage current distances of the
terminal board connection bolts shorten; this can result in winding and
terminal board damage.
Wear personal protective clothing such as goggles and protective
gloves!
Avoid overfilling the system with refrigerant!
To avoid shifts in concentration, zeotropic refrigerant blends must
always only be filled into the refrigerating plant in liquid form.
Do not pour liquid coolant through the suction line valve on
the compressor.
It is not permissible to mix additives with the oil and
refrigerant.
